Your contribution will support programs like the TIRF Kathleen M. Bailey Teacher-Research Award, the TIRF Doctoral Dissertations Grants program, the TIRF James E. Alatis Prize for Research in Language Policy and Planning in Educational Contexts, and our publication and resource activities. Collectively, these programs promote research in our field and provide opportunities for individuals around the world to engage with critical issues we grapple with in language education.

Additionally, your donation will bolster our research mentoring efforts. The TIRF Bailey Award involves pairing experienced scholars in our field with awardees. By shining a light on the importance of mentorship, TIRF fosters a culture of guidance and collaboration, ensuring the continued growth and development of emerging scholars in the field.
